What is Blockchain Interoperability and Why Does It Matter?
Blockchain interoperability is the ability of different blockchain networks to communicate and exchange information seamlessly. Imagine a world where various cryptocurrencies, like Bitcoin and Ethereum, can work together as easily as texting between different phone brands. This capability is crucial because it allows for a more unified ecosystem, enhancing the overall utility and user experience.

Key Challenges in Achieving Blockchain Interoperability
While the idea of interoperability sounds promising, several challenges stand in the way. One major issue is the varying consensus mechanisms used by different blockchains, which can complicate how they communicate. It’s like trying to play a game where everyone follows different rules; confusion and miscommunication are bound to happen.

Another challenge is the lack of standardized protocols for interoperability. Without a common language or set of guidelines, blockchains struggle to connect with one another effectively. This situation can lead to security vulnerabilities and data integrity issues, which are critical concerns for users and developers alike.

Current Approaches to Enhance Interoperability
Several approaches are being explored to improve blockchain interoperability, each with its unique advantages and challenges. One popular method is the use of atomic swaps, which allow users to exchange cryptocurrencies from different blockchains without the need for a trusted third party. This technique is akin to a direct trade between friends, ensuring both parties get exactly what they want without any middleman.

Another promising solution is the development of cross-chain protocols, like Polkadot and Cosmos, which are designed to facilitate communication between different blockchains. These platforms enable multiple chains to interoperate, much like a universal remote that can control various devices. By using these protocols, developers can create applications that harness the strengths of multiple blockchains.
Additionally, wrapped tokens are gaining traction as a way to bridge assets across blockchains. For example, Wrapped Bitcoin (WBTC) allows Bitcoin to be used on the Ethereum network, effectively merging the two ecosystems. This not only enhances liquidity but also broadens the utility of these digital assets, making them more versatile for users.
The Role of Smart Contracts in Interoperability
Smart contracts play a crucial role in facilitating blockchain interoperability by automating processes and ensuring compliance across different networks. Essentially, they are self-executing contracts with the terms of the agreement directly written into code. This automation reduces the need for intermediaries and minimizes the potential for errors, much like a vending machine that dispenses the right product when you input the correct amount.
By utilizing smart contracts, developers can create decentralized applications (dApps) that leverage the features of multiple blockchains simultaneously. This capability allows for more complex interactions, such as executing transactions across multiple networks in a single action. Real-World Examples of Interoperability in Action
Real-world applications of blockchain interoperability are already emerging, showcasing its potential impact on various industries. One notable example is the collaboration between different supply chain networks, where multiple stakeholders can track products across various blockchains. This transparency not only improves efficiency but also builds trust among consumers, as they can verify the authenticity of products.
Another example is the decentralized finance (DeFi) space, where platforms like Aave and Uniswap enable users to access liquidity across different blockchains. By facilitating seamless asset swaps and lending across networks, these platforms are redefining traditional financial services.
